Subtle custom design

It is clear at first glance that the Galaxy S24 speaks the same design language as other Samsung devices. This is due to the flat glass back, metal sides and the three separate cameras on the back. Samsung has made minor adjustments, because the sides are now almost completely flat, except for a subtle rounding towards the back.

Combine this with the handy size of the regular S24 and the device fits comfortably in the hand. Unfortunately, the smartphone offers little grip due to the matte back, making it easier to let it slip out of your hands.

Furthermore, the device is again equipped with clear stereo speakers with Dolby Atmos, buttons on the right and a SIM card slot. All in all, this is a housing that you would expect from a high-end smartphone.

Hardware performs surprisingly well

It may be a bit of an exaggeration that the Exynos name strikes a chord with Samsung fans. However, processors from Samsung’s own kitchen were not exactly popular in the past. Fortunately, you have little to complain about with the Exynos 2400, because the chip is very smooth.

Playing games, switching between apps and opening large 3D files goes smoothly on the S24, which feels smooth, especially with the 120Hz screen. The Exynos 2400 seems to be a lot less energy efficient than the Snapdragon chips. You can read more about this later in this review.

Furthermore, the Galaxy S24 is available in two variants, both with 8GB of RAM. The cheapest model has 128GB of storage, which in combination with a cloud subscription will be more than sufficient. Want to store more photos, apps or files locally? Then there is also a 256GB version.

Screen you want to look at for hours

A Dynamic LTPO AMOLED 2X screen with a 120Hz refresh rate, HDR10+ colors, a maximum brightness of 2600 nits and protection by a layer of Gorilla Glass Victus 2. That is not only a mouthful, but they are also the ingredients for a screen of very High Quality. Samsung has outdone itself once again.

Although the Galaxy S24 ‘only’ has a Full HD resolution of 2340 by 1080 pixels, the compact size of 6.2 inches makes it sharp enough. In addition, the screen edges are incredibly thin and symmetrical. The brightness automatically adjusts to show HDR images clearly, but at the same time keeps the menus dim.

Software packed with Galaxy AI

During the launch of the S24, Samsung paid the most attention to Galaxy AI. This name covers several useful artificial intelligence functions that the manufacturer has incorporated into the One UI 6.1 shell of Android 14. In our experience, there are mainly a lot of small functions that you use occasionally, but certainly not all of them.

There are various language functions with AI, including Live Translate that can translate calls and messages between different languages. This works fine and also on WhatsApp, but Dutch is not yet supported. Chat Assist can also help you write messages in a different tone, but these often appear to be written by AI.

In collaboration with Google, the Galaxy S24 also features Circle to Search. This allows you to draw a circle around an object you encounter on your smartphone at any time, after which information will appear. In practice you won’t use the function too often, but it is certainly useful to have. However, do you use swipe gestures instead of a navigation bar? Then activating the Circle to Search mode is quite inconvenient.

Furthermore, the One UI shell is exactly what you have come to expect from Samsung. For example, menus look a lot different than on stock Android and you have exclusive access to the Galaxy Store. In addition, Samsung provides the Galaxy S24 with seven years of software and security updates, so you can use it until 2031.

Cameras take more realistic pictures

The set of cameras on the Samsung Galaxy S24 is identical to those on the predecessor. The new flagship is again equipped with a 50 megapixel main camera, 12 megapixel wide-angle lens and the optical telephoto lens has a resolution of 10 megapixel.

Pictures on the S24 are especially striking because of the natural colors. The smartphone does not take photos too colorful and the contrast is lower than its predecessor. Photos on the S24 also seem to be sharpened less. This applies to the main and wide-angle lens. The zoom camera does smartly sharpen objects, especially if you zoom in further than the optical ‘3x zoom’.

The cameras don’t perform particularly well in the dark unless you hold the phone still for long enough. Unfortunately, movement often means a blurry photo and again the flash still cannot be used with the wide-angle lens.

Of course, Samsung also brings AI to the cameras. In this way, artificial intelligence combines the different cameras for the sharpest picture and the best quality. You can also edit photos better with the AI.

Use Samsung’s Gallery app to straighten photos, generate missing parts and remove reflections from windows. All in all, the functions often work well with simple photos and good lighting conditions. However, we don’t think you’ll use them often.

Battery for a (busy) day and charging

Let’s start with the facts with the battery: the battery has grown from 3900 mAh to 4000 mAh, it still charges at 25 Watts and can charge other devices (wirelessly). The increased capacity is of course minimal, which means that in practice you will not see a major improvement compared to its predecessor.

To be honest, the battery life of the Galaxy S24 is quite disappointing. On average, we get a measly five hours of active screen time from the phone. That’s fine if you don’t use the smartphone much, for example on a busy working day. Do you want to play games for an afternoon or do you use the device a lot during the day? Then you probably need to recharge in the evening.

The charging speed of the S24 is again a maximum of 25 Watts. Samsung does this to keep the battery in good condition for as long as possible, but this does mean that it takes about an hour and a half for the smartphone to charge from 0 to 100 percent. You should take this into account a little more before you leave the house.

Wireless charging is again possible at 15 Watts and takes almost two hours. Reverse wireless charging of other devices is even slower, but is especially useful in emergencies.

Conclusion Samsung Galaxy S24 review

With a recommended retail price of 899 euros, the Samsung Galaxy S24 is in a different price range than the S24 Plus and S24 Ultra, but it is equipped with a very bright screen with a high refresh rate, an extensive set of cameras, a smooth chip and the same smart software functions.

In our opinion, the only thing you really need to cut back on is the battery, because it simply won’t hold up to intensive use. Do you not use your smartphone all day long, but do you want a high-end device when you do use it? Then the Galaxy S24 is definitely recommended.

The new Samsung S24

The Samsung Galaxy S24, S24 Plus and S24 Ultra are the manufacturer’s latest flagships. On the outside they resemble their predecessors, the Galaxy S23 series, but of course plenty of things have changed. The screen edges are thinner and completely symmetrical and all devices have a flat screen. The curved edges are a thing of the past.

The S24, the entry-level model, has a 6.2-inch screen and the new Exynos 2400 chip. This processor is also in the Galaxy S24 Plus, which has a 6.7-inch display. Samsung mainly focuses on artificial intelligence in the form of ‘Galaxy AI’. These are a number of smart software functions that are on the devices.

The ultimate Samsung flagship is the Galaxy S24 Ultra. The phone has a larger 6.8-inch screen, faster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 chip and the best cameras of the trio. The phone also has a large 5000 mAh and the S-Pen: the stylus with which you take notes.

It is good to know that the Samsung Galaxy S24 and S24 Plus have become 50 euros cheaper compared to their S23 predecessors. You pay for the regular S24 899 euroswhile the Plus version 1149 euros costs. The S24 Ultra, on the other hand, is 50 euros more expensive and takes precedence 1449 euros over the counter.

“Prices of Samsung Galaxy S24 smartphones leaked”


Samsung will introduce the Galaxy S24 series on January 17, but the suspected euro prices have already emerged in the rumor circuit. It is noticeable that the Galaxy S24 and S24+ have a lower suggested retail price than their predecessors.

The European recommended prices have been shared by the German website SamaGame. According to the source, the Galaxy S24 will soon be sold for 899 euros. This concerns the version with 8GB of RAM and 128GB of storage space. The Galaxy S23 with the same configuration had a suggested retail price of 949 euros. The Galaxy S24+ is also 50 euros cheaper, the source said. The Galaxy S24+ costs 1149 euros. For this price you also get 12GB of RAM instead of 8GB on the Galaxy S23+.

It is striking that the Galaxy S24 Ultra, unlike the other two models, is actually 50 euros more expensive, according to SamaGame. The smartphone has a starting price of 1449 euros. You also get 12GB of RAM instead of 8GB with the S24 Ultra. In terms of storage space, you can choose between 256GB, 512GB and 1TB.

Install an S24 Ultra wallpaper yourself

Would you also like to set one of these backgrounds on your smartphone? Then download the desired images. You do this by selecting the photo of your choice in the X app or web browser and then clicking on the three dots at the top right of the screen. Press save and the photo will be downloaded.

Then go to the settings app on your smartphone. Here, click on ‘Customization’, then ‘Background & Style’ and click on ‘Change Background’. Now find the background in ‘My Photos’ and select it. Then set whether you want to use it for your home and/or lock screen and you’re done.

This is what we expect from the S24 Ultra

The Samsung Galaxy S24 Ultra is the largest model in the S24 series. The smartphone is made of titanium and contains the well-known S-Pen. The screen on the Ultra has a size of 6.8 inches and contains an OLED panel that shows bright colors, as we have come to expect from Samsung. For the first time, the edges of the screen are not rounded, but flat.

The S24 is equipped with the latest chip of the moment: the Snapdragon 8 Gen 3. There is also 12GB of RAM and up to 1TB of storage space. The battery has a size of 5000 mAh and charges with a maximum of 45 watts. The smartphone can also charge wirelessly and supply power to other devices.

On the back of the S24 Ultra you will find most cameras from the S24 line. There is again a main camera and wide-angle camera, but the 10x telephoto lens disappears. This will be a camera with a higher resolution, but one that can zoom in less optically.

2. More flexible telephoto shooting

The combination of two telephoto lenses and 200 megapixel main camera made zooming with the predecessor S23 Ultra very powerful. The triple optical telephoto and the tenx optical telephoto together covered an enormous zoom range and the 200 MP sensor had more than sufficient sharpness reserves for double zooming. But there was a larger gap between the two zoom lenses. When zoomed between magnification factors between 4 and 9, the 10 MP sensor of the smaller telephoto no longer offered sharp images. With the S24 Ultra, Samsung is reportedly adapting the telephoto pair better to the requirements of everyday life. The second telephoto intervenes at zoom factor 5 (with 5x optical magnification), and a 50 MP sensor should ensure sufficient sharpness, even at 10x zoom. This means that the image quality remains consistently high over a larger zoom range. The only weak point: the smaller telephoto unfortunately remains at only 10 MP, so the quality of photos with 4x zoom will not change much. The main camera will probably stay at 200 MP, but will supposedly spit out standard photos in 24 MP instead of 12 MP – if that’s true, Samsung learned this trick from Apple. According to rumors, a new sensor will also be installed that can absorb more light thanks to larger sensor pixels. The camera of the basic models S24 and S24 Plus is much simpler, only has a telephoto and no 200 MP main camera.

3. New super processor only on the S24 Ultra

The S24 series comes with new processors. But the S24 Ultra will probably be the only model that will benefit from the latest Qualcomm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 processor. It has what it takes to be the fastest processor in the Android world and, in addition to a slightly faster CPU (only clocked higher for Samsung), offers stronger graphics, for example for games and, above all, a much stronger neural processor unit (NPU), so that AI Applications run directly on the device even without the cloud. Let’s hope that Samsung gives the S24 Ultra an improved cooling system, like we saw with the Fold 5. The basic models S24 and S24 Plus also get a new processor, but “only” the Exynos 2400 directly from Samsung. In some details the Exynos is behind the Snapdragon, but the general level is probably similar.

4. OLED display – brighter than Apple!

The S24 Ultra is rumored to have a display with a brightness of up to 2,600 nits. This is a huge leap compared to the already good 1,750 nits of the predecessor, and therefore overtakes it Apple’s iPhone 15 Pro Max (almost 2,100 nits or candelas per square meter).

5. Wifi 7: More speed, less disruption

2024 will be WiFi 7 is picking up speed – also because Germany’s most important router manufacturer AVM is finally bringing new FritzBox models with Wifi 7 onto the market. Wifi 7 offers more robustness and speed, especially in congested metropolitan areas. Since Wifi 7 is integrated directly into the new Snapdragon processor, the base models could remain with Wifi 6E.

6. New design with titanium power

Model Apple: Like the iPhone 15 Pro models, the S24 Ultra comes with a frame made of titanium alloy. Basically, titanium as a metal is lighter than steel but stronger than aluminum. However, the test of the iPhone 15 Pro showed that titanium does not work wonders when it comes to robustness and scratch resistance – but the price could be slightly higher than its predecessor at 1,469 euros for the 256 GB version (smallest storage size). But titanium looks and feels great and will probably also come with a matt surface that is easier to grip. The new design also has measurable advantages: the display frame should be slightly narrower. And S-Pen users will be pleased that the display is no longer so rounded at the edges. This leaves more space for drawing and writing.
